T.J. Maxx Grand Opening in Georgetown, Set for Tomorrow


Finally, someone's going into the Shops at Georgetown Park, instead of the other way around. Discount retailer T.J. Maxx celebrates its grand opening at the iconic (and redeveloping) Georgetown mall tomorrow at 8:00 AM. Fashionistas in Georgetown? Say it ain't so!
T.J. Maxx will partner with Home Goods, a home fashions (furniture, mirrors, pillows, etc.) retailer that advertises savings at up to 60% off... You know the deal. Co-owners Vornado Realty Trust and Angelo Gordon & Co. have been busy for the past couple of years demolishing the mall's interior. The idea... to switch from small, mostly independent retailers to big-box, national chains such as Bloomingdale's and Target. Target is the big catch; but they've been recently linked to the former ESPN Zone space at 11th & E Streets, NW.

Georgetown isn't the only new destination for T.J. Maxx. Next month, the Jenifer Street location in Friendship Heights moves across the street (literally) to Mazza Gallerie, into the former digs of the much-missed Filene's Basement. I had hopes for a Marshall's, but c'est la vie.
